Total Time: 1 hr 5 minsCategory: Main CourseCalories: 338 per serving1. Place all of the ingredients in a large cast-iron dutch oven. B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ce to simmer, cover and cook for about 45 minutes until pork is tender.
2. Remove the lid and turn the heat to medium-high to reduce the liquid. Once the liquid is reduced the meat will start to fry in its fat.
3. Brown the meat over medium-low heat stirring frequently and breaking the pork apart with the back of the spoon or spatula until pork is evenly browned and crispy, this takes about 15 minutes. Taste for salt and serve.

Total Time: 4 hrs 15 minsCategory: Main CourseCalories: 261 per serving1. Rinse pork and pat dry with a paper towel. Cut into large chunks. Salt and pepper the pork.
2. In a 6-quart stock pot over medium-high heat, add 1 tbsp olive oil. When hot, add pork pieces and brown on all sides, about 3 minutes per side.
3. Add the cumin, oregano, garlic cloves, orange juice, water and bay leaves to the pot.
4. Cover and simmer over low heat for 3-4 hours, turning the meat at least once during cooking, until the meat is tender (it falls apart when forked). Alternative: If cooking in a slow cooker, cover and cook on low heat 5-6 hours. In the pressure cooker, cook for 45 minutes on high pressure.
